This paper presents LTE analyses of two sharp-lined early B stars,
γ Pegasi and ι Herculis, based on co-added IIaO and Reticon
2.4 Å spectrograms of the photographic region. Most of the derived
abundances are close to solar. Both stars have definite microturbulences
which probably are related to the instability of their photo spheres.
